宁波大数据挖掘软件有很多种选择,如Hadoop、Spark、KNIME、RapidMiner、Tableau等。在这些软件中,Hadoop是一个广泛使用的开源大数据框架,它能够处理大量的非结构化数据,适用于大规模的数据处理任务。Hadoop的核心是其分布式文件系统(HDFS),使得数据可以跨多台服务器存储和处理,从而提高数据处理的效率和可靠性。Spark是一个快速的、通用的集群计算系统,KNIME和RapidMiner则是用户友好的数据分析平台,适合数据科学家和分析师使用。Tableau则以其强大的数据可视化功能而著称,能够帮助用户直观地理解数据背后的故事。
一、HADOOP:大数据处理的基石
Hadoop作为大数据处理的基础框架,已经被广泛应用于各种行业。它的核心组件包括HDFS(分布式文件系统)和MapReduce(分布式计算框架),能够高效地处理和存储大量的非结构化数据。Hadoop的扩展性和容错性使其成为处理大规模数据集的理想选择。Hadoop生态系统中还有许多其他工具,如Pig、Hive、HBase和YARN,这些工具进一步扩展了Hadoop的功能,使其能够处理各种复杂的数据分析任务。Pig和Hive是数据仓库工具,可以用于数据的提取、转换和加载(ETL)任务,HBase是一种NoSQL数据库,适用于实时数据存取,YARN是资源管理器,负责管理集群的计算资源。
二、SPARK:高速大数据处理引擎
Spark是一个通用的集群计算系统,主要用于大数据处理。它的内存计算能力使得数据处理速度比Hadoop快很多倍。Spark支持多种编程语言,包括Java、Scala、Python和R,这使得数据科学家和工程师可以使用自己熟悉的语言来编写数据处理任务。Spark的核心是其强大的数据处理引擎,可以高效地执行复杂的查询和算法。Spark还提供了一些高级库,如Spark SQL、MLlib(机器学习库)、GraphX(图计算库)和Spark Streaming(流处理库),这些库使得Spark不仅适用于批处理任务,还可以处理实时数据分析和复杂的机器学习任务。
三、KNIME:用户友好的数据分析平台
KNIME(Konstanz Information Miner)是一个开源的数据分析平台,用户界面友好,适合没有编程背景的用户使用。KNIME提供了一个可视化的工作流界面,用户可以通过拖放操作来设计数据分析流程。KNIME支持各种数据源,如数据库、文件和Web服务,并且集成了多种数据分析工具和算法,用户可以轻松地进行数据预处理、数据挖掘和数据可视化。KNIME还支持与其他工具的集成,如R、Python和H2O,这使得用户可以利用这些工具的强大功能来扩展KNIME的能力。
四、RAPIDMINER:强大的数据挖掘软件
RapidMiner是另一个流行的数据挖掘软件,它提供了全面的数据分析和机器学习功能。RapidMiner的用户界面直观,适合没有编程背景的用户使用。用户可以通过拖放操作来设计和执行数据挖掘任务。RapidMiner支持多种数据源,并集成了大量的机器学习算法,用户可以轻松地进行数据预处理、特征选择、模型训练和评估。RapidMiner还提供了自动化机器学习(AutoML)功能,可以帮助用户自动选择最佳的模型和参数,从而提高数据分析的效率和准确性。
五、TABLEAU:强大的数据可视化工具
Tableau是一款领先的数据可视化工具,能够帮助用户轻松创建交互式的图表和仪表板。Tableau支持多种数据源,包括数据库、文件和云服务,用户可以通过拖放操作来连接和分析数据。Tableau的强大之处在于其直观的用户界面和丰富的可视化选项,用户可以轻松地创建各种图表,如柱状图、折线图、饼图和地图等。Tableau还支持高级分析功能,如计算字段、参数和过滤器,用户可以通过这些功能来深入挖掘数据背后的故事。Tableau的仪表板功能允许用户将多个图表和数据源整合在一起,创建一个全面的数据分析视图,从而帮助企业做出更明智的决策。
六、HADOOP与SPARK的对比分析
Hadoop和Spark都是大数据处理的核心工具,但它们在性能、使用场景和生态系统方面存在一些差异。Hadoop的优势在于其稳定性和扩展性,适用于大规模的批处理任务,特别是当数据量非常庞大时。Hadoop的MapReduce框架虽然强大,但其迭代计算效率较低,这使得它不太适用于需要多次迭代的任务,如机器学习算法。Spark则弥补了这一缺点,其内存计算能力使得迭代计算的速度大大提高,适用于需要快速处理的数据分析任务。Spark的高级库(如Spark SQL和MLlib)进一步扩展了其功能,使得Spark不仅适用于批处理任务,还可以进行实时数据分析和复杂的机器学习任务。
七、KNIME与RAPIDMINER的对比分析
KNIME和RapidMiner都是用户友好的数据分析平台,但它们在功能和使用体验上有所不同。KNIME的优势在于其开放性和可扩展性,用户可以通过插件来扩展KNIME的功能。KNIME的工作流界面直观,用户可以通过拖放操作来设计数据分析流程,这使得KNIME非常适合没有编程背景的用户。RapidMiner则以其全面的数据挖掘和机器学习功能而著称,用户可以轻松地进行数据预处理、特征选择、模型训练和评估。RapidMiner的自动化机器学习功能可以帮助用户自动选择最佳的模型和参数,从而提高数据分析的效率和准确性。两者各有优势,用户可以根据自己的需求选择合适的平台。
八、TABLEAU在数据可视化中的应用
Tableau在数据可视化方面的应用非常广泛,特别是在商业智能和数据分析领域。企业可以使用Tableau来创建交互式的图表和仪表板,从而直观地展示数据分析结果。Tableau的强大之处在于其直观的用户界面和丰富的可视化选项,用户可以轻松地创建各种图表,如柱状图、折线图、饼图和地图等。Tableau还支持高级分析功能,如计算字段、参数和过滤器,用户可以通过这些功能来深入挖掘数据背后的故事。Tableau的仪表板功能允许用户将多个图表和数据源整合在一起,创建一个全面的数据分析视图,从而帮助企业做出更明智的决策。Tableau在金融、零售、医疗等行业都有广泛的应用,能够帮助企业提高数据分析的效率和准确性。
九、大数据挖掘软件的选择指南
选择合适的大数据挖掘软件需要考虑多个因素,包括数据量、分析需求、用户技能水平和预算等。对于需要处理大规模数据集的企业,Hadoop和Spark是理想的选择。Hadoop适用于批处理任务,特别是当数据量非常庞大时,其扩展性和稳定性使其成为处理大规模数据集的首选。Spark则适用于需要快速处理的数据分析任务,其内存计算能力和高级库(如Spark SQL和MLlib)使其成为实时数据分析和复杂机器学习任务的理想选择。对于没有编程背景的用户,KNIME和RapidMiner是不错的选择。KNIME的开放性和可扩展性使其非常适合各种数据分析任务,用户可以通过插件来扩展其功能。RapidMiner则以其全面的数据挖掘和机器学习功能而著称,用户可以轻松地进行数据预处理、特征选择、模型训练和评估。Tableau则适用于需要强大数据可视化功能的用户,其直观的用户界面和丰富的可视化选项使其成为商业智能和数据分析领域的首选工具。
十、宁波大数据挖掘软件的未来趋势
随着大数据技术的不断发展,宁波的大数据挖掘软件也在不断进化。未来,这些软件将更加智能化和自动化,能够更好地满足企业的数据分析需求。人工智能和机器学习技术的应用将使得大数据挖掘软件能够自动发现数据中的模式和规律,从而提高数据分析的效率和准确性。云计算技术的普及将使得大数据挖掘软件能够处理更大规模的数据集,并且更加灵活和可扩展。数据隐私和安全将成为一个重要的关注点,未来的大数据挖掘软件将更加注重数据的保护和合规性。总之,宁波的大数据挖掘软件将在技术创新和市场需求的驱动下不断发展,为企业提供更加高效和智能的数据分析解决方案。
相关问答FAQs:
宁波大数据挖掘软件有哪些?
在宁波,随着数字经济的发展,大数据挖掘软件的需求日益增加。多种软件被广泛应用于不同的行业和领域,以实现数据的深度分析和价值挖掘。以下是一些在宁波较为知名的大数据挖掘软件:
-
Hadoop:这是一个开源框架,能够处理大规模数据集。Hadoop的分布式存储和处理能力使其在宁波的许多企业中得到了广泛应用,尤其是在电商、金融和制造业等行业。
-
Spark:Apache Spark是一个强大的开源数据处理引擎,专注于大数据分析和实时数据处理。宁波的一些科技公司使用Spark来加速数据分析过程,提升业务决策的效率。
-
Tableau:作为一种强大的数据可视化工具,Tableau被许多宁波企业用于数据分析和报告生成。其直观的界面和强大的功能,使得非技术人员也能够轻松地进行数据挖掘。
-
SAS:SAS是一款专业的数据分析软件,提供了强大的统计分析和预测建模功能。在宁波的一些金融机构和科研单位,SAS被用于深入的数据分析和决策支持。
-
RapidMiner:这是一个集成的数据科学平台,允许用户构建和部署预测模型。宁波的许多初创公司和数据分析团队使用RapidMiner进行数据挖掘和机器学习。
-
KNIME:KNIME是一个开源数据分析平台,适合用于数据挖掘和机器学习。宁波的一些高校和研究机构利用KNIME进行教学和研究,推动了数据科学的发展。
-
Python及其库(如Pandas, NumPy, Scikit-learn):Python已经成为数据科学领域的主流语言。宁波的开发者和数据科学家利用Python及其丰富的库进行数据挖掘和分析,灵活性和强大的社区支持使其成为热门选择。
-
R语言:R是一种专门用于统计分析和数据可视化的编程语言。在宁波的科研和教育领域,R被广泛用于数据挖掘和分析。
-
Alteryx:这是一个数据分析平台,提供数据准备、数据融合和高级分析的功能。宁波的一些企业使用Alteryx来提高数据分析的效率和准确性。
-
Microsoft Power BI:这是一款商业智能工具,提供数据可视化和报告功能。许多宁波企业利用Power BI来分析业务数据,进行实时监控和决策支持。
随着大数据技术的不断发展和应用,宁波的大数据挖掘软件市场也在不断扩展。这些软件不仅提高了数据分析的效率,还为企业的决策提供了更为坚实的基础。
大数据挖掘软件如何帮助企业提升竞争力?
大数据挖掘软件在企业发展中起着至关重要的作用,其通过数据分析和挖掘为企业提供了深入的见解和决策支持,进一步提升了企业的竞争力。以下是一些具体的方面:
-
精准营销:通过大数据分析,企业能够深入了解客户的需求和行为模式,从而实施更为精准的营销策略。例如,电商企业可以根据用户的购买历史和浏览记录,推送个性化的产品推荐,提升销售转化率。
-
优化运营:大数据挖掘软件能够分析企业的运营数据,识别瓶颈和效率低下的环节。通过优化供应链管理和库存控制,企业可以降低成本,提高运营效率。
-
风险管理:金融行业特别依赖大数据挖掘来进行风险评估和管理。通过分析历史交易数据和市场趋势,企业能够更好地预测潜在风险,制定相应的应对策略。
-
创新产品:大数据分析可以帮助企业识别市场需求和趋势,从而推动产品创新。通过挖掘用户反馈和市场数据,企业可以开发出更符合消费者需求的新产品。
-
提升客户体验:企业可以通过大数据分析深入了解客户的反馈和满意度,从而制定更为人性化的服务策略。提升客户体验不仅能增强客户忠诚度,还能吸引新客户。
-
决策支持:大数据挖掘软件提供的数据分析和可视化工具,可以帮助企业高层做出更为科学和准确的决策。通过实时监控和分析业务数据,企业能够快速响应市场变化。
-
人才管理:通过分析员工的绩效数据和离职率,企业能够优化招聘和培训策略,提高员工的满意度和留任率。
-
市场竞争分析:企业可以通过大数据分析竞争对手的表现和市场趋势,制定更具竞争力的策略。了解市场动态能够帮助企业在激烈的竞争中保持优势。
-
社交媒体分析:企业可以利用大数据挖掘软件分析社交媒体上的用户反馈和趋势,了解品牌形象和用户情感,从而调整营销策略。
-
数据驱动决策文化:通过推广大数据分析的应用,企业能够培养数据驱动的决策文化,提升整体的管理水平和效率。
通过以上多个方面的应用,大数据挖掘软件为企业提供了强大的支持。随着技术的不断进步,未来大数据挖掘将在更多领域发挥重要作用。
如何选择适合的宁波大数据挖掘软件?
选择适合的宁波大数据挖掘软件对于企业来说至关重要。以下是一些关键因素,可以帮助企业在众多选项中做出明智的选择:
-
需求分析:在选择软件之前,企业应先明确自身的需求和目标。是希望进行数据分析、可视化,还是机器学习等?明确需求后,才能更有针对性地选择软件。
-
用户友好性:软件的易用性是一个重要因素。对于缺乏技术背景的用户,选择一个操作简单、界面友好的软件可以大大降低学习成本,提高工作效率。
-
功能丰富性:不同的软件提供的功能各异,企业需根据自身需求选择功能相对全面的软件。例如,是否需要支持实时数据处理、数据清洗、预测分析等功能。
-
集成能力:考虑软件是否能够与现有的系统和工具进行无缝集成。例如,是否能够与企业的CRM、ERP系统等进行数据对接,增强数据的利用价值。
-
支持与培训:优质的软件供应商通常会提供良好的技术支持和培训服务。企业在选择软件时,应关注供应商的服务能力,以便在使用过程中获得帮助。
-
社区和生态系统:一些开源软件拥有活跃的社区和丰富的生态系统,用户可以通过社区获得支持和资源。这种社区的支持能够帮助企业更好地使用软件。
-
成本与预算:企业在选择软件时,需考虑预算限制。不同软件的定价策略有所不同,既包括一次性购买费用,也包括后续的维护和升级费用。
-
安全性:数据安全是企业在选择大数据挖掘软件时不可忽视的因素。确保所选软件具备良好的安全性,能够有效保护企业的数据资产。
-
可扩展性:企业的需求可能会随着业务的发展而变化,因此选择一款具有良好可扩展性的软件,可以在未来轻松适应新需求。
-
案例参考:了解其他企业在使用某款软件后的反馈和成功案例,可以为决策提供参考。询问同行业的朋友或者查阅相关评测,获取真实的使用体验。
结合以上因素,企业可以更有针对性地选择适合自身需求的大数据挖掘软件,以实现数据的有效利用和业务的持续发展。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。